.sound-wave-wrap{display:inline-block;width:100%;max-width:680px;position:relative;perspective:1200px;transform-style:preserve-3d}.sound-wave{width:100%;height:auto;display:block;transform-origin:center center}.sound-wave rect{fill:#12141d}.sound-anim-block{display:none!important}.sound-anim-block.sound-step-0{display:flex!important;flex-direction:column;justify-content:center;align-items:stretch;min-height:100%;position:relative;overflow:visible}.sound-anim-block.sound-step-0{position:relative}.sound-anim-block.sound-step-0>*:not(.sound-bg-crossfade){position:relative;z-index:1}.sound-bg-crossfade{position:absolute;inset:0;z-index:0;pointer-events:none}.sound-bg-reveal{position:absolute;inset:0;z-index:0;background:#12141d;transform:scale(0);transform-origin:center;will-change:transform}.sound-steps-row,.sound-anim-block.sound-step-0 .sound-steps-row{display:flex;justify-content:center;align-items:center;flex-wrap:nowrap!important;box-sizing:border-box;overflow:visible}#sound-linked-overlay .linked-stick{position:fixed;left:50%;transform:translateX(-50%);max-width:min(92vw,1200px);display:block;opacity:1;padding:0;margin:0;pointer-events:auto;cursor:pointer}#sound-linked-overlay .linked-stick.top{top:var(--overlay-top-offset)}#sound-linked-overlay .linked-stick.bottom{bottom:var(--overlay-bottom-offset)}#sound-linked-overlay .linked-title-inner{display:flex;align-items:baseline;column-gap:.25em;background:0 0!important;-webkit-backdrop-filter:none!important;backdrop-filter:none!important;padding:0;border-radius:0;font-weight:700;font-size:clamp(16px,2vw,28px);line-height:1.1;color:#fff}#sound-linked-overlay .lt-part{display:inline-block;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;max-width:42vw}#sound-linked-overlay .lt-2{color:#8238ed}.title-part-1,.title-part-2,.text-sound-step{flex:0 0 auto;text-align:center;overflow:visible}.text-sound-step{width:0;max-width:100%;will-change:width}.text-sound-step .text-col-inner{will-change:opacity,transform}.title-part-1,.title-part-2{backface-visibility:hidden;transition:none!important;will-change:transform}.title-part-1,.title-part-2,.text-sound-step{transition:none!important}.title-part-1,.text-sound-step,.title-part-2{order:unset!important}.text-sound-step.centered-final{margin-left:auto!important;margin-right:auto!important}.text-sound-step.centered-final~.title-part-1,.text-sound-step.centered-final~.title-part-2{transform:none!important}@media (min-width:981px){.sound-anim-block.sound-step-0 .title-part-1,.sound-anim-block.sound-step-0 .title-part-2{display:block!important;opacity:1!important;visibility:visible!important}}.sound-anim-block.sound-step-0 .text-sound-step{display:block!important;opacity:1!important;visibility:visible!important}@media (max-width:980px){.sound-anim-block .title-part-1,.sound-anim-block .title-part-2{display:none!important}}